Europe Heat Wave Shifts East Amid Ongoing Business Disruptions

Europe's scorching heat wave is gradually shifting eastward, offering slight relief to parts of Spain and France while maintaining record-breaking intensity. The thermal event continues disrupting normal operations across multiple regions.

The persistent high temperatures strain agricultural systems, with crop yields facing significant stress under sustained heat exposure. Energy grids also experience elevated pressure as cooling demands surge across residential and commercial sectors.

Supply chains grapple with operational disruptions as businesses adapt to unprecedented environmental conditions. Infrastructure systems manage increased thermal loads while maintaining basic functionality throughout affected areas.

The ongoing heat event fundamentally challenges European operations, forcing rapid adaptation across agriculture, energy, and logistics sectors as businesses navigate the unprecedented thermal conditions.
